After phosphorylation by PDK1, PKC undergoes autophosphorylation at two sites important for PKC activity, one in the turn motif (Thr-642 in PKCB) and the second in the hydrophobic phosphorylation motif (Ser-661 in PKCB). These phosphorylations render the enzyme catalytically competent but still inactive; diacylglycerol (DAG) and calcium are required for full activation.
